Output b89aa382c191f0ef02ffbb9b3eb0a6e397ee4f09880ac4fc7d24b396cd048b56:3

value
11112952
script pubkey
OP_0 OP_PUSHBYTES_20 8876589becae95bf0d744a8e50d2d2a7c8dbaf61
address
bc1q3pm93xlv462m7rt5f289p5kj5lydhtmpxhcaru
transaction
b89aa382c191f0ef02ffbb9b3eb0a6e397ee4f09880ac4fc7d24b396cd048b56
spent
true